TINGLAYAN, Kalinga – The Philippine Drug Enforcement Agency-Cordillera uprooted marijuana worth P3.4 million in a three-day eradication operation in Barangay Butbut here from September 14 to 16.
PDEA-Cordillera Director Julius Paderes said they discovered two plantations with a total land area of 17,000-square meters.
Paderes said 17,000 fully grown marijuana plants were uprooted and burned on-site.
No cultivator was arrested but Paderes thanked partner law enforcement agencies for supporting PDEA-Cordillera in their marijuana eradication campaign.
